Ubuntu系统下香港服务器高级运维实战指南
文章分类:技术文档 /
创建时间:2025-12-17
在资源有限的环境中,通过Ubuntu系统高效完成香港服务器的高级运维部署,能有效提升服务器性能与稳定性。以下从前期准备到日常维护,逐一解析关键操作。
前期准备:确保部署基础
部署香港服务器前需完成三项核心准备。首先确认服务器访问权限,包括IP地址、用户名及密码,这是远程操作的基础;其次准备Ubuntu系统镜像文件,推荐选择长期支持版本(如Ubuntu 20.04 LTS),兼顾稳定性与更新支持;最后确保网络连接稳定,避免因断连导致安装或配置中断。
系统安装与基础配置
通过SSH工具远程登录香港服务器后,使用准备好的镜像文件启动系统安装。安装过程中需根据业务需求完成分区设置(如单独划分/var、/home目录)、管理员账户创建等步骤。安装完成后,首要操作是更新系统软件包:
sudo apt update
sudo apt upgrade
这两条命令能同步最新软件源并修复已知安全漏洞,确保系统处于最佳状态。
安全设置:构建防护屏障
服务器安全是运维的核心。第一步修改默认SSH端口,降低被恶意扫描的风险:编辑`/etc/ssh/sshd_config`文件,将`Port 22`修改为不常用端口(如12345),保存后重启SSH服务:
sudo systemctl restart sshd
第二步配置防火墙,使用ufw(Uncomplicated Firewall)工具管理更便捷。通过以下命令开放常用端口:
sudo ufw allow 12345/tcp # 开放修改后的SSH端口
sudo ufw allow 80/tcp # 开放HTTP端口
sudo ufw allow 443/tcp # 开放HTTPS端口
sudo ufw enable # 启用防火墙
启用后,防火墙会拦截未授权的外部连接请求。
性能优化:提升资源利用率
在资源有限的场景下,优化系统参数能显著提升服务器响应速度。编辑`/etc/sysctl.conf`文件,添加或调整以下参数:
net.ipv4.tcp_syncookies = 1 # 启用SYN Cookie防止洪水攻击
net.ipv4.tcp_max_syn_backlog = 2048 # 增加半连接队列容量
net.ipv4.tcp_synack_retries = 2 # 减少重传次数降低资源消耗
保存后执行`sudo sysctl -p`使配置生效。此外,定期使用`df -h`命令检查磁盘空间,清理日志文件或迁移冗余数据,避免因空间不足影响服务运行。
监控与维护:保障持续稳定
实时监控是发现潜在问题的关键。使用`top`或`htop`工具可快速查看CPU、内存、磁盘I/O的实时占用情况;若需更全面的监控,可安装Prometheus(监控数据采集)与Grafana(可视化展示),通过图表直观分析服务器负载趋势。
数据备份是运维的最后防线。建议使用`rsync`工具定期将网站文件、数据库等重要数据备份至外部存储或另一台服务器,命令示例:
rsync -avz --delete /path/to/source user@backup_server:/path/to/backup
该命令会同步源目录与备份目录,确保数据一致性。
通过以上步骤,可在Ubuntu系统下完成香港服务器的高级运维部署,在有限资源中实现性能、安全与稳定性的平衡,为业务运行提供可靠支撑。
上一篇: K8s集群部署VPS海外常见技术问答
下一篇: 外贸独立站选美国服务器,这3个配置是关键
工信部备案:粤ICP备18132883号-2